Two Souls, One Mate
Photo by Brooke Cagle on Unsplash

Dear Adam,

You and I;

we're two halves to one whole.

You and I;

we're two peas in a pod.

You and I;

we're two souls to one mate.

Were.

You and I;

we were two halves to one whole.

You and I;

we were two peas in a pod.

You and I;

we were two souls to one mate.

You were my everything,

Adam.

The only one I thought I'd spend

the rest of my days with.

We were the most perfect pair,

Adam.

I couldn't imagine living a life

without you,

my sweetest angel;

my one protector.

Love always,

Michelle
